Product Description
The Canon PIXMA PRO-10 Wireless Professional Inkjet Photo Printer features a 4800 x 2400 dpi resolution and Canon's FINE technology with an ink drop as small as 4.0 pl. The printer's 10-cartridge ink system provides a wide color range and includes 3 black inks for high-quality black-and-white photos. The Pro-10 can output borderless prints up to 13 x 19" and is compatible with a wide range of media, including glossy, luster, and matte photo paper as well as Museum Etching and other fine art papers. Additionally, you can print directly on CDs, DVDs, and Blu-ray discs and create your own customizable discs and jackets. The included Print Studio Pro plug in software provides an easy way to achieve optimal results when printing directly from Adobe Photoshop CS and Elements, as well as from Adobe Photoshop Lightroom. The PIXMA Pro-10 features multiple connectivity options so you can easily print from your different devices. In addition to a standard USB connection, you can connect to the printer over a wired or wireless Ethernet network. Additionally, you can use the front-facing USB port to print directly from a compatible digital camera with PictBridge compatibility.

Yes it's big, and it's heavy, but I have a permanent home for mine, right next to my desk, and don't plan to be moving it often, if at all.
I'm not going to subtract any stars for this, but I couldn't get it to work on either wifi or wired ethernet. The setup software just simply wouldn't see it on either my iMac or my Macbook Pro, though it was showing as connected in my router manager. So I decided to quit messing about and wasting time and connected it to the iMac via USB, and that's fine. If I want to print something from the Macbook I just copy it to the NAS drive and print from the iMac, no great problem when you consider it's going to take several minutes to print, and 70 years to fade!
Still on my first set of ink cartridges. Of course, the cartridges are depleting at different rates. Grey is just about done, yellow is very low, but at least two or three of the others seem to be still full. I've ordered a full set of ten new cartridges, plus an additional grey, but only time will tell how quickly they all deplete, but I think the advice should be to order cartridges individually as needed; I mean, you can get them next day right here at Amazon. One of the cartridges is called Matte Black. I wonder if this one is only used if you print on matte paper? If so, that cartridge just won't get used as I'm always glossy. Again, only time will tell.
Be careful on paper. Some brands and types are incompatible and could damage the printer. I'm sticking with Canon Photo Paper Plus Glossy II for smaller sizes, and Ilford Galerie for A3 and A3+. Both are lovely glossy papers, and there's a couple of ICC profile choices for the Ilford paper. Looks like that 100-pack of HP Everyday Gloss in my cupboard needs a new home.
As for the actual mechanics of printing: I use Adobe Lightroom for all my photographical needs, and have installed Canon's own plugin called Print Studio Pro, which is invoked from LR direct. It works well and has all the necessary adjustments and settings you're likely to need. Just one caveat on printing: before invoking Print Studio Pro remember to crop your photograph into the exact proportions of the intended paper size, e.g., 4x6 or 5x7, as the height to width proportions differ. If you send an uncropped pic to print you will NOT get borderless, if that's what you need, as the printer will NOT auto-crop and expand the image to fill the paper, but will instead leave uneven white borders. A suitably cropped pic will give perfect borderless every time, even on A3+.
Finally, don't make the mistake of thinking this is an all-purpose printer. I sent a short Word document with just a few non-black words in it for print on A4 plain paper and it took as long to print as a full colour A4 photograph. This is a photo printer, remember that, though it does come with a CD printing thingie, which I'll never use..
Fast forward 6 years and I needed a replacement as my old canon pixma was donated to my daughter and, my current multifunction printer isn't upto the task. Unpacking the printer, removing all the protective tape, powering up the printer and installing the print head and the 10 ink cartridges took around 15 minutes, I connected the USB cable to my MacBook and installed the printer drivers and applications very easily. The one issue I had was locating the print head alignment routine on the Mac, no print head alignment occurred automatically even with paper in the sheet feeder, so I plan to perform this from a windows machine at a later date.
A test page was printed on regular printer paper to check everything was good, no issues.
I was itching to see what the print quality was like so I quickly located a photo of our Bengal cross female kitten taken recently with my 10 year old Nikon D70s dslr with a Nikon 50mm f1.4 lens. The kitten's marking consists of blacks, Browns, whites and greys running in differing directions so I was interested to see the printed result.
Inserting half a dozen sheets of canon glossy photo paper I selected print to A4 and pressed the go button, the result was simply breathtaking, her markings, the fur colour and even individual hair and whiskers all printed out beautifully, there are no issues with the print at all and I'm very happy with results so far. Next job is to finish screen calibration and get my desktop set up and get back into my lost love of photography.
After my first print out I set the wifi up which was simplicity in itself, I look forward to the forthcoming years and hope that this Canon product brings the joy and reliability of my previous Canon printer, some might say it should do at that price; but then it sits in the same bracket as my old Nikon camera as an enthusiast imaging device and I want at least enthusiast results.
Only issue is it is fussy with paper and has few choices on its menu.Also insists in only printing on some papers if they are places in the single sheet feeder. Not good if you need several hand outs or brochures. I find that contrary to the instructions it works OK with almost any paper and certainly prints envelopes. However, manual duplexing is a bit of a pain, but is nevertheless handled well as it prints all the page 1s and then gets you to turn the stack for page 2. So just about OK for day to day work if you're not to busy and have patience, but wonderful printing even in monochrome with the right paper.
